Surface Prep work
Before repainting your home, make sure to extensively prepare the surface areas by cleansing and fixing any blemishes. Beginning by washing the walls with a light cleaning agent solution to get rid of dust, dirt, and oil. Utilize a sponge or cloth to scrub delicately, making certain all surfaces are tidy and completely dry before proceeding.

Shade and End Up Selection
To accomplish the desired aesthetic for your home, very carefully pick the shades and surfaces that will certainly boost the overall look of each space. When picking shades, consider the mood you intend to produce in each area. Lighter shades can make an area really feel more sizable and airy, while darker tones can add heat and coziness. Consider the natural light that enters the room and how it might impact the shade throughout the day.
Along with color, the finish of the paint is additionally vital. Matte surfaces can conceal imperfections however may be harder to cleanse, while satin and semi-gloss finishes are extra resilient and washable. Shiny coatings can add a touch of elegance however might highlight imperfections in the wall surfaces.
Keep in mind that various spaces may gain from various color pattern and coatings based on their function and the ambience you wish to create.

Furniture and Décor Defense
Think about covering your furniture and decoration items to secure them from paint splatters and leaks during the professional painting process. Usage plastic ground cloth or old bedsheets to shield your valuables from unintended spills.
Move furnishings to the center of the area or into another area far from the walls being painted. If moving huge things isn't feasible, team them with each other and cover with protective materials.
For smaller décor pieces, eliminate them from the area completely if feasible. If removing them isn't an alternative, thoroughly cover them in plastic or towel to avoid paint damages.

Do not forget about your flooring. Put down protective coverings like rosin paper or textile drop cloths to shield carpets, wood floors, or floor tiles from paint splatters. Secure the coverings in position with painter's tape to prevent any kind of crashes while the paint remains in progression.
Taking these safety measures will help make certain that your furnishings, design, and floorings stay in leading condition during the professional painting process.
